Schulte Companies is a prominent third-party management company recognized for its deep, multi-generational expertise in the hospitality industry. With a diverse team composed of innovative hoteliers and restaurateurs, the company proudly operates over 200 locations across 38 states in the United States and extends its reach to three countries. Their vast portfolio includes well-established brands such as Marriott, Hilton, IHG, and Hyatt, alongside numerous unique, independent, boutique, and lifestyle properties and restaurants. This combination of corporate sophistication and independent creativity highlights Schulte Companies as a leader in providing exceptional hospitality services. Job Duties
- Seats and takes accurate food orders from guests
- monitor food distribution, ensuring meals are delivered correctly and properly presented
- checks station before, during and after shift for proper set-up and cleanliness
- abide by all state, federal and corporate liquor regulations
- must be familiar with all menu items, their preparation and service procedure
- totals checks, presents to guests and accepts payment
- assists with bussing tables
- perform various other duties as assigned
